(1) There is hereby created the Colorado beef council authority, which shall be a body corporate and a political subdivision of the state. The authority shall not be an agency of state government, nor shall it be subject to administrative direction by any state agency except: (a) As provided in this article; (b) For purposes of the “Colorado Governmental Immunity Act”, article 10 of title 24 , C.R.S.; (c) For purposes of inclusion in the risk management fund and the self-insured property fund and by the department of personnel pursuant to part 15 of article 30 of title 24 , C.R.S.
